Calling all backyard gardeners, home cooks and green-thumbed families! Do you have the crispest vegetables, the most stunning homegrown bouquets or a delicious homemade creation?
The University of Hawaiʻi at Mānoa College of Tropical Agriculture and Human Resilience (CTAHR) invites community members to showcase their homegrown products in Hoʻonani the Harvest, a fun, family-friendly competition at the upcoming 60th Annual Hawaiʻi State Farm Fair!

Ribbons and bragging rights will be awarded to top entries. Fairgoers are encouraged to visit the CTAHR pavilion during the event to view the displays and learn more about home gardening, pest management and sustainable agricultural practices directly from UH Mānoa experts.
